Why FAANG Interviews Are So Unique—and So Challenging


FAANG companies don’t just want coders—they want thinkers, collaborators, and problem solvers. The interview process is often five to seven rounds deep and includes:

  • Coding rounds with algorithmic problems under time pressure

  • System design questions that test your ability to think at scale

  • Behavioral rounds to evaluate communication, leadership, and culture fit

  • Role-specific or domain-driven questions depending on the team


Each component requires a distinct strategy. Generic preparation won’t get you across the finish line. To truly succeed, your FAANG interview prep must be focused, realistic, and personalized.
